Navigating the Nuances: Responsible Consumption of Imperfect Portrayals
Prioritize critical analysis of adult entertainment content. Scrutinize depictions for unrealistic body standards, coerced interactions, and power imbalances. Recognize these portrayals as constructed narratives, not reflections of real-world relationships.
Actively seek out diverse and ethical sources of adult media. Favor productions that prioritize consent, inclusivity, and accurate representation of human sexuality. Support creators who promote positive and respectful depictions.
Evaluate the effect of viewed material on personal expectations and relationships. Discuss potential discrepancies with partners. Adjust consumption habits to align with healthy attitudes toward sex and intimacy.
Consult with a therapist or sex educator if you experience distress, anxiety, or unrealistic expectations related to adult content. Professional guidance can aid in processing complex emotions and developing a healthier relationship with sexuality.
Engage in media literacy practices. Research the production practices of different studios and platforms. Understand the potential impact of algorithms and targeted advertising on content consumption habits.
Set firm boundaries for personal consumption. Limit viewing time, curate a watchlist of preferred content, and avoid using adult media as a primary source of sexual education or relationship models.
Advocate for ethical production standards within the adult entertainment industry. Support organizations that work to improve working conditions, promote consent, and combat exploitation.

From Screen to Bedroom: Translating Intense Yearnings Into Intimate Experiences
Prioritize open communication. Initiate a dialogue with your partner about what specifically captivates you in viewed material. Instead of broad statements, pinpoint specific scenes, actions, or aesthetics that resonate.
- Specificity is key: „I appreciate the slow, sensual touch in that scene“ is more helpful than „I like the vibe.“
Introduce elements gradually. Replicating entire scenes can feel forced. Instead, isolate specific techniques or scenarios that you find stimulating and adapt them to your shared comfort level.
- Start small: Try incorporating a new type of caress or a specific phrase.
Focus on the emotional connection. Intense gratification doesn’t always translate into authentic closeness. Use the viewed material as a springboard for discussing your fantasies and vulnerabilities.
- Share fantasies: Explain the underlying emotions or desires connected to your fantasies.
Experiment with sensory details. If a particular visual style is appealing, explore how to recreate similar effects in your bedroom through lighting, textures, or attire.
- Lighting matters: Experiment with dim lighting or colored bulbs to create a specific mood.
- Texture play: Introduce different fabrics or materials to enhance tactile sensations.
Remember consent and boundaries. Regularly check in with your partner to ensure they are comfortable and enjoying the experience. Establish clear signals for indicating discomfort or a desire to stop.
- Safe words: Agree on a word or phrase that signals an immediate stop without explanation.
Shift the focus from performance to pleasure. The goal is not to perfectly replicate what you see on screen, but to enhance your shared enjoyment and connection.
- Embrace imperfection: Focus on the feelings and sensations, not achieving a specific outcome.
Consider guided exploration. If discussing preferences feels challenging, explore resources like intimacy workshops or couples therapy to facilitate open communication and exploration.
